Output 99952fe6a9f0c1280da4348c0ad150cf19bc17cd3de0d418e15d91f40d8b73a7:414

value
31669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d6e4a2a4b76ae6416c02db61a0ca039c456a70 OP_EQUAL
address
3MuzgyPjW8RfYDEVNyRm6FYgN8hobWZjYQ
transaction
99952fe6a9f0c1280da4348c0ad150cf19bc17cd3de0d418e15d91f40d8b73a7
spent
true